NEW DELHI: Bowler Rusty Theron of the USA has accused Pakistani pacer Haris Rauf of tampering with the ball during Thursday's T20 World Cup play in Dallas.

Theron, who is not on the USA team, claimed that the ball was reversing because Rauf was dragging his thumbnails across it after two overs.

The 38-year-old seamer, who previously represented South Africa, also blasted the ICC for allegedly ignoring the incident.

"@ICC are we just going to pretend Pakistan aren't scratching the hell out of this freshly changed ball? Reversing the ball that's just been changed 2 overs ago?

"You can literally see Haris Rauf running his thumb nail over the ball at the top of his mark. @usacricket #PakvsUSA," Theron wrote on 'X'.



In the first upset of this T20 World Cup, co-hosts USA surprised Pakistan on Thursday by defeating the former champions in a Super Over.

Rauf, who gave up 37 runs in four overs, was Pakistan's most costly bowler.
